Art Nouveau Gilded Bronze Serving Tray Platter with Iris Flowers, France 1910s

About the Item

This adorable large Art Nouveau serving tray or centerpiece was hand-crafted in France circa 1910. The impressive platter boasts an oval-shaped gilded bronze framing with fine detailing and is ornated with dimensional garlands of iris flowers. The design is characteristic of the Art Nouveau style aesthetic. There is no visible maker's mark. The felted underside has been fully restored to its original green condition. It will effectively protect your furniture pieces when using the tray. Good antique condition, with some shadow traces in the mirrored glass. Check the picture with a black marking. Some signs of aging and use and a slight verdigris patina on bronze, but it does not significantly affect the overall appearance. Measurements: 23.23 in wide (59 cm) x 16.57 in deep (42 cm) x 1.19 in high (3 cm). Note: Glasses are not included in the sale.

Note: In 1856, after earning a Fine Arts diploma, Giuseppe Sambonet, son of a nobleman from Vercelli, got a Master Goldsmith license and established the company Giuseppe Sambonet, registering the seal bearing the initials "GS" with the mint in Turin. By the early 20th Century, his company was the Official Supplier to many noble families, including the Duchess of Genoa and the Count of Turin. In 1932, Sambonet was the first company in Italy to build an industrial manufacturing plant for sterling silver and galvanic silverware. In 1938, it developed an innovative process of producing stainless steel flatware and a silver-plated steel manufacturing technique. In 1947, it started manufacturing stainless steel knives and blades using its technology. In 1956, Sambonet conquered the international market and bit 53 competitors to supply the Hilton Hotel in Cairo with a hollowware line that remains in its collection today.
